松辽盆地北部火山岩锆石SHRIMP测年与营城组时代探讨

摘    要:前人对松辽盆地营城组的时代存在不同认识。利用松辽盆地北部徐家围子断陷区营城组广泛发育的中—酸性火山岩取芯资料,开展了详细的火山岩锆石SHRIMP U-Pb年代学研究,结果表明营城组火山岩年龄集中在113—111Ma之间,属于早白垩世晚期的Aptian与Albian界线附近,从而明确该套火山岩应发育在营城组中上部的新认识,并由此说明营城组的顶界已跨入Albian。因此,认为松辽盆地营城组的时代为Hauterivian到Albian。

SHRIMP ZIRCON U-Pb GEOCHRONOLOGY OF VOLCANIC ROCKS AND DISCUSSION ON THE GEOLOGICAL TIME OF THE YINGCHENG FORMATION OF THE NORTHERN SONGLIAO BASIN

Abstract:The age of the Yingcheng Formation in the Songliao Basin has been disputed. A suite of volcanic intermediate rocks to acidites, mainly acidic eruptive rocks, occurs widely in the Yingcheng Formation in the Xujiaweizi fault-depression in the northern Songliao Basin. SHRIMP zircon U-Pb geochronology gives ages between 111Ma and 113Ma for the volcanic rocks indicating that the volcanic succession formed around Aptian-Albian of the Early Cretaceous. Accordingly it is concluded that this suite of volcanic rocks was emplaced at the middle-upper part of the Yingcheng Formation. Based on available information, the age of the Yingcheng Formation in the northern Songliao Basin is most likely between Hauterivian and Albian.
